主页 > imtoken多签钱包 > Pi节点区块链组件即将开源,GitHub上92%的区块链开源项目都没了?

Pi节点区块链组件即将开源,GitHub上92%的区块链开源项目都没了?

imtoken多签钱包 2023-12-18 05:09:32

根据 Pi 官方社区管理员的最新消息,Pi Network 节点的区块链组件将开源,项目正在组织一个 github 存储库以继续开源。我们的目标是直接在 github 存储库中维护一个未解决问题列表,社区成员可以根据需要对其做出贡献,因此请密切关注。

无论是互联网还是区块链,作为一种技术,开源与否都存在争议。 Java 的不完全开源曾经招来不少诟病,现在 Pi 却被诟病不开源。

什么是开源?

人们经常听到这个项目是开源的比特币项目开源代码,这实际上意味着该项目遵循开源许可,源代码是公开的,任何人都可以查看。在计算机开发的早期,软件几乎是开放的,任何人都可以查看软件的源代码。然而微软的出现打破了这种局面,他们在分发软件时不再包含源代码。从那时起,专有软件的时代已经到来。然而,随着以开源代码为特色的区块链技术的出现,以及极客社区的高度认可,它开始重新进入历史舞台。现在大部分项目都选择在 Github 上开源。

Github 是谁?

gitHub 是开源和专有软件项目的托管平台,之所以命名为 GitHub,是因为它只支持将 Github 作为唯一的托管存储库格式。

GitHub 于 2008 年 4 月 10 日正式上线。除了 Github 代码仓库托管和基本的 web 管理界面,Github 还提供订阅、讨论组、文本渲染、在线文件编辑器、协作图(报告)、代码片段分享(要点)和其他功能。目前全球有数千万开发者,中国有近百万开发者使用Github。

为什么区块链项目应该开源?

简单来说,区块链技术就是一个很多人都可以阅读和使用的大账本。这个大账本需要多方合作。但在合作过程中,如何快速建立互信?如何让合作企业直接在陌生平台上做生意?也许最好的方法是开源。项目方选择开源,意味着将获得更少的项目漏洞、更低的开发成本和更强的创新能力。面对如此多的优势,NEO的创始人哒哒甚至说出了狠话:不开源的都是流氓。

区块链项目必须是开源的吗?

有趣的是,据相关数据显示,自 2009 年比特币开源以来,GitHub(开源和私有软件项目的托管平台)每年新增超过 8000 个区块链项目。迄今为止,已有超过 3W 个区块链项目,其中 92% 处于非活动状态且半死不活,只有大约 8% 处于活动状态(过去六个月至少更新一次)。

那么问题来了,开源项目大量死亡的原因是什么?或者换句话说,开源有什么不好?

当项目完全开源时,源代码对所有人开放,包括一些别有用心的人。黑客一直在攻击区块链。看到源代码后,项目方更有可能利用它。这样的例子在币圈经常出现。

最典型的例子是孙晨宇的抄袭,孙晨宇对沉V很生气,说TRX复制粘贴白皮书的效率远高于原版。

浅谈 Pi 对 Pi 开源的建议:

在我看来,现阶段需要依靠不断升级的技术手段来获取用户流量。这时候我们可以选择开源一些代码,也就是开源一些非核心部分比特币项目开源代码,进行宣传,赢得合作伙伴的信任。当项目开发达到行业领先水平,并在系统上构建了丰富的应用程序后,代码可以一一开放。这个时候,即使出现重复应用,也不会动摇它的行业地位,就像比特币永远是比特币一样,因为它首先出现,并且已经在大众心中形成了共识。

在我看来,只要敢开源的项目对自己的技术水平有信心,即将开源的 Pi 也可以说明 Pi 已经被广泛使用。在项目中经过检验,具备全社会参与、质疑甚至抵制的能力。